Charkhara is a village in Barasat - I Block, also recorded as a Census sub-district, North Twenty Four Parganas district, West Bengal. For Charkhara, the population is 2,772, PIN code is 743248 and Census village code is 323177. Charkhara comes under Charkhara gram panchayat and Barasat - I C.D. Block. Its local administrative unit is Barasat - I Block, also recorded as a Census sub-district. The block headquarters is Chhota Jagulia at 2.70 km. The Census district headquarters, Barasat, is 7 km away.
